Article Why does my LT8357 circuit draw high current when starting up, even under no output load?

There are two time periods where a Boost converter, even under no load, can have high input current levels. 

The first time period is before the Boost converter even starts to switch which is referred to as inrush, as there is a path from the input to output through the inductor and diode. The current during this period is only limited by the impedances in the circuit.

The second period is when the output capacitors are charged from 0V (or VIN, see above) up to the target output voltage. The current during this period is limited by either the Soft Start function, or the current sense resistor hitting its upper threshold. These design values would be determined by the maximum output current, and by conservation of energy the peak input current is always higher than the designed maximum output current for a Boost converter.
